proc parseAuthority(authority: string, result: var TUri) =
|
||||
var i = 0
|
||||
var inPort = false
|
||||
while true:
|
||||
case authority[i]
|
||||
of '@':
|
||||
result.password = result.port
|
||||
result.port = ""
|
||||
result.username = result.hostname
|
||||
result.hostname = ""
|
||||
inPort = false
|
||||
of ':':
|
||||
inPort = true
|
||||
of '\0': break
|
||||
else:
|
||||
if inPort:
|
||||
result.port.add(authority[i])
|
||||
else:
|
||||
result.hostname.add(authority[i])
|
||||
i.inc
|
||||
|
||||
proc parsePath(uri: string, i: var int, result: var TUri) =
|
||||
|
||||
i.inc parseUntil(uri, result.path, {'?', '#'}, i)
|
||||
|
||||
# The 'mailto' scheme's PATH actually contains the hostname/username
|
||||
if result.scheme.ToLower() == "mailto":
|
||||
parseAuthority(result.path, result)
|
||||
result.path = ""
|
||||
|
||||
if uri[i] == '?':
|
||||
i.inc # Skip '?'
|
||||
i.inc parseUntil(uri, result.query, {'#'}, i)
|
||||
|
||||
if uri[i] == '#':
|
||||
i.inc # Skip '#'
|
||||
i.inc parseUntil(uri, result.anchor, {}, i)
|
||||
|
||||
proc initUri(): TUri =
|
||||
result = TUri(scheme: "", username: "", password: "", hostname: "", port: "",
|
||||
path: "", query: "", anchor: "")
|
||||
|
||||
proc parseUri*(uri: string): TUri =
|
||||
## Parses a URI.
|
||||
result = initUri()
|
||||
|
||||
var i = 0
|
||||
|
||||
# Check if this is a reference URI (relative URI)
|
||||
if uri[i] == '/':
|
||||
parsePath(uri, i, result)
|
||||
return
|
||||
|
||||
# Scheme
|
||||
i.inc parseWhile(uri, result.scheme, Letters + Digits + {'+', '-', '.'}, i)
|
||||
if uri[i] != ':':
|
||||
# Assume this is a reference URI (relative URI)
|
||||
i = 0
|
||||
result.scheme = ""
|
||||
parsePath(uri, i, result)
|
||||
return
|
||||
i.inc # Skip ':'
|
||||
|
||||
# Authority
|
||||
if uri[i] == '/' and uri[i+1] == '/':
|
||||
i.inc(2) # Skip //
|
||||
var authority = ""
|
||||
i.inc parseUntil(uri, authority, {'/', '?', '#'}, i)
|
||||
if authority == "":
|
||||
raise newException(EInvalidValue, "Expected authority got nothing.")
|
||||
parseAuthority(authority, result)
|
||||
|
||||
# Path
|
||||
parsePath(uri, i, result)
|
||||
|
||||
proc removeDotSegments(path: string): string =
|
||||
var collection: seq[string] = @[]
|
||||
let endsWithSlash = path[path.len-1] == '/'
|
||||
var i = 0
|
||||
var currentSegment = ""
|
||||
while true:
|
||||
case path[i]
|
||||
of '/':
|
||||
collection.add(currentSegment)
|
||||
currentSegment = ""
|
||||
of '.':
|
||||
if path[i+1] == '.' and path[i+2] == '/':
|
||||
if collection.len > 0:
|
||||
discard collection.pop()
|
||||
i.inc 3
|
||||
continue
|
||||
elif path[i+1] == '/':
|
||||
i.inc 2
|
||||
continue
|
||||
currentSegment.add path[i]
|
||||
of '\0':
|
||||
if currentSegment != "":
|
||||
collection.add currentSegment
|
||||
break
|
||||
else:
|
||||
currentSegment.add path[i]
|
||||
i.inc
|
||||
|
||||
result = collection.join("/")
|
||||
if endsWithSlash: result.add '/'
|
||||
|
||||
proc merge(base, reference: TUri): string =
|
||||
# http://tools.ietf.org/html/rfc3986#section-5.2.3
|
||||
if base.hostname != "" and base.path == "":
|

proc combine*(base: TUri, reference: TUri): TUri =
|
||||
## Combines a base URI with a reference URI.
|
||||
##
|
||||
## This uses the algorithm specified in
|
||||
## `section 5.2.2 of RFC 3986 <http://tools.ietf.org/html/rfc3986#section-5.2.2>`_.
|
||||
##
|
||||
## This means that the slashes inside the base URI's path as well as reference
|
||||
## URI's path affect the resulting URI.
|
||||
##
|
||||
## For building URIs you may wish to use \`/\` instead.
|
||||
##
|
||||
## Examples:
|
||||
##
|
||||
## .. code-block:: nimrod
|
||||
## let foo = combine(parseUri("http://example.com/foo/bar"), parseUri("/baz"))
|
||||
## assert foo.path == "/baz"
|
||||
##
|
||||
## let bar = combine(parseUri("http://example.com/foo/bar"), parseUri("baz"))
|
||||
## assert foo.path == "/foo/baz"
|
||||
##
|
||||
## let bar = combine(parseUri("http://example.com/foo/bar/"), parseUri("baz"))
|
||||
## assert foo.path == "/foo/bar/baz"
|
||||
|
||||
template setAuthority(dest, src: expr): stmt =
|
||||
dest.hostname = src.hostname
|
||||
dest.username = src.username
|
||||
dest.port = src.port
|
||||
dest.password = src.password
|
||||
|
||||
result = initUri()
|
||||
if reference.scheme != base.scheme and reference.scheme != "":
|
||||
result = reference
|
||||
result.path = removeDotSegments(result.path)
|
||||
else:
|
||||
if reference.hostname != "":
|
||||
setAuthority(result, reference)
|
||||
result.path = removeDotSegments(reference.path)
|
||||
result.query = reference.query
|
||||
else:
|
||||
if reference.path == "":
|
||||
result.path = base.path
|
||||
if reference.query != "":
|
||||
result.query = reference.query
|
||||
else:
|
||||
result.query = base.query
|
||||
else:
|
||||
if reference.path.startsWith("/"):
|
||||
result.path = removeDotSegments(reference.path)
|
||||
else:
|
||||
result.path = removeDotSegments(merge(base, reference))
|
||||
result.query = reference.query
|
||||
setAuthority(result, base)
|
||||
result.scheme = base.scheme
|
||||
result.anchor = reference.anchor
|
||||
|
||||
proc combine*(uris: varargs[TUri]): TUri =
|
||||
## Combines multiple URIs together.
|
||||
result = uris[0]
|
||||
for i in 1 .. <uris.len:
|
||||
result = combine(result, uris[i])
|
||||
|
||||
proc `/`*(x: TUri, path: string): TUri =
|
||||
## Concatenates the path specified to the specified URI's path.
|
||||
##
|
||||
## Contrary to the ``combine`` procedure you do not have to worry about
|
||||
## the slashes at the beginning and end of the path and URI's path
|
||||
## respectively.
|
||||
##
|
||||
## Examples:
|
||||
##
|
||||
## .. code-block:: nimrod
|
||||
## let foo = parseUri("http://example.com/foo/bar") / parseUri("/baz")
|
||||
## assert foo.path == "/foo/bar/baz"
|
||||
##
|
||||
## let bar = parseUri("http://example.com/foo/bar") / parseUri("baz")
|
||||
## assert foo.path == "/foo/bar/baz"
|
||||
##
|
||||
## let bar = parseUri("http://example.com/foo/bar/") / parseUri("baz")
|
||||
## assert foo.path == "/foo/bar/baz"
|
||||
result = x
|
||||
if result.path[result.path.len-1] == '/':
|
||||
if path[0] == '/':
|
||||
result.path.add(path[1 .. path.len-1])
|
||||
else:
|
||||
result.path.add(path)
|
||||
else:
|
||||
if path[0] != '/':
|
||||
result.path.add '/'
|
||||
result.path.add(path)
|
||||
|
||||
